Exegesis

The oracle formula koh-amar {כֹּה־אָמַר | kô-hā-ˈmār} ‘thus says’ introduces divine speech.

Root and etymology

ʾ-m-r

to speak, say

In context2 Kings 22:15

And she said to them, “Thus says the LORD God of Israel : ‘Say to the man who sent you to Me .’”

About this coordinate

2 Kings 22:15:3 is a BCV:P reference — Book · Chapter · Verse · Word Position. It addresses word 3 of 2 Kings 22:15, so the Hebrew word כֹּֽה־אָמַ֥ר (koamar) can be cited, linked and studied at exactly this position rather than somewhere in the verse. In the Biblical Knowledge Coordinate System the same position is written 2 Kgs.22.15.W3, which extends further down to each syllable (2 Kgs.22.15.W3.S1) and character.
